The Offshore Reality

These platforms don’t answer to the UK Gambling Commission. They operate under licenses from jurisdictions like Curacao. That’s not inherently bad. It just means the rules of engagement are different. You get less meddling in your personal data, but you also lose the strong local recourse if a payout goes sour. You’re playing under their house rules, not the UK’s. For a lot of players who value privacy over protectionism, that trade-off is worth it.

Where the Value Actually Sits

Let’s cut through the marketing. The real draw isn’t the bonus-it’s the withdrawal speed. Crypto and e-wallet cashouts clear in minutes or hours, not the three to five business days you’re used to. That’s the killer feature.

  • Instant access. No 48-hour verification hold. Register with an email and a password, and you’re live.
  • Real privacy. Your bank statement won’t show casino deposits. Your identity isn’t sitting in a database waiting to be breached.
  • Fast payouts. This is the main event. Stick to Bitcoin, Ethereum, or Skrill to get your funds back in your pocket almost instantly.
  • The catch. Bonus terms can be punishing. High wagering requirements are common. And if you trigger a dispute, you’re subject to the whims of an offshore regulator. Read the fine print like your bankroll depends on it-because it does.

Picking the Right Operator

Not all KYC-free sites are built equal. Look for operators with a long track record in the space. Check player forums for real withdrawal reports. A site that’s been paying out for five years is a safer bet than a flashy new skin with a giant bonus. Prioritize platforms that offer live chat and clear, transparent withdrawal policies. If the terms are buried or vague, walk away.
